Expected Cutoffs: What to Anticipate
According to various educational experts and previous trends, the anticipated cutoffs for MBBS programs in Karnataka’s government medical colleges may see fluctuations due to a variety of factors, including the number of applicants and the complexities of NEET 2025. Historically, colleges such as Bangalore Medical College and Research Institute and Mysore Medical College have shown a competitive landscape, often requiring scores in the range of 550-600 for top placements.
Factors Influencing MBBS Cutoffs in Karnataka
The expected cutoffs are influenced by several vital elements. The increasing popularity of the medical profession and the limited number of seats in reputed government colleges contribute significantly to rising cutoff marks. Moreover, factors such as prior years’ performance, the overall difficulty level of the exam, and the medical council’s review of admission policies also play notable roles. Understanding these dynamics helps aspiring students and their families prepare effectively.

Steps Towards Successful Preparation
To excel in NEET 2025, whether aiming for a government college in Karnataka or otherwise, students should follow a structured preparation strategy:
- Understand the Syllabus: Familiarize yourself with the NEET syllabus to ensure no essential topic is overlooked.
- Utilize Online Resources: Websites and apps offer tailored study material and interactive learning opportunities.
- Join a Study Group: Collaborating with peers can provide motivation and facilitate information exchange.
- Maintain Mental Health: Engage in relaxation techniques and schedule regular breaks to sustain focus.
